Circuit Board Terminals

Terminals Installed on Circuit Board
Terminals fit into 0.042" dia. holes so you can make connections to a circuit board.
Insert wraparound terminal into a hole and wrap wire around the top. Soldering is not needed. The post scores the sides of the hole for a secure grip.
